Catch Basins
A catch basin is a box-like drain that’s placed in the ground where standing water tends to accumulate. It features a grate that allows water and debris to drain from the top, which is then connected to an underground piping system that leads to the local drainage or storm sewers.
The main function of a catch basin is to funnel away excess rainwater from problem areas. This helps prevent flooding, puddles, and soil erosion that could cause damage to landscaping or driveways. In addition, it prevents contaminated water from flowing into groundwater sources and damaging local plant life.
During heavy periods of rainfall, a catch basin can also help protect indoor areas from long-term moisture problems, which can damage flooring and furniture. Additionally, since a catch basin removes stagnant water, it can reduce the amount of bugs and bacteria that thrive in warm, moist areas.
Lastly, a catch basin can increase your property value by preventing drainage issues like flooding and mold from occurring. A professional can examine your drainage issues and recommend the right catch basin solution for you.
Permeable Pavers
Permeable pavers allow surface water to pass through their surfaces into the ground beneath. This can help to prevent flooding, puddling and ice accumulation that can occur on driveways, patios, walkways, parking lots and other impervious surfaces.
Many municipalities require sustainable stormwater management practices, and choosing to install a pervious paving system on your property can be a great way to comply with those requirements. In addition, these systems can help reduce the amount of pollutants that are carried into local waterways and rivers from paved surfaces.
Unlike traditional concrete, asphalt and brick, permeable paving stones have void spaces and a layered structure that helps to reduce absorbed heat. This can help to reduce the urban heat island effect. In addition, the underlying stone layers can undergo natural filtration and help to improve water quality in local aquifers and lakes.
While permeable paving is not as cost-effective as standard concrete, it can be less expensive than other options like paver stones or concrete slabs. In most cases, these systems are installed on top of a base that is open graded and made up of large gravel, medium sized gravel and what is called “fines.” This material creates a holding tank for the water until it can seep into the soil below called sub soil. This allows the water to be used by plants and trees, reducing your water bill.

French Drain
A French drain is an advanced drainage solution designed to prevent water damage to your property’s foundation, landscaping and home. It’s much more effective and reliable than a simple ditch because it directs water away from the house rather than into or around it.
This is accomplished by digging a trench, adding landscape fabric, then installing perforated pipe underneath a layer of gravel. Gravel size is chosen based on soil types and other site conditions to avoid pooling or stagnation. The piping is then covered with a filter sleeve to prevent debris from entering the perforations and clogging the drain. The piping is often placed at a downward-sloping angle so that gravity will quickly funnel water away from the house.
The pipe can be made of either corrugated plastic or PVC. In the case of PVC, it’s important to use slotted piping instead of holes because the slots reduce the number of fine soil particles that can enter and clog the pipes. It’s also important to consider the dimensions of the piping when choosing it for your French drain. Pipes with a larger diameter are usually preferred for areas expected to experience heavy rainfall and soil saturation.

Dry Creek Bed
Unlike French Drains, dry creek beds offer a more aesthetically pleasing drainage solution. Essentially they are slightly sunken paths made of rock and gravel that work with your existing landscape to help divert water away from problem areas. They can be designed to resemble a natural stream or creek and are a popular addition to landscapes because they can add a rustic, natural look to your yard.
The first step in constructing a dry creek bed is marking out the path that you would like to dig. Usually we suggest a winding path as this looks most natural, however the choice is completely up to you. Once the area has been marked out we dig the creek bed, removing any existing landscaping plants as needed. Then we lay a grounding fabric such as Groundtex, a multi-purpose woven geotextile. Once this is laid we then cover it with river rock such as pea gravel or coastal Scottish cobbles.
When the project is complete, plantings can be added around the creek bed to soften the hardscape look. Some popular options are low growing groundcovers that are unaffected by water levels such as marsh marigold and wood betony, as well as flowering shrubs and bushes that will add year-round interest to your landscape such as blazing star and wild geranium.

Why Exhaust Upgrades Add Horsepower
Before diving into specific products, it’s helpful to understand why aftermarket exhausts add more horsepower compared to stock restrictive exhausts:
Increased Diameter - Larger diameter tubing reduces backpressure which robs power.
Smoother Bends - Mandrel bent tubes have a corrugated interior to maintain smooth air flow.
High-Flow Mufflers - Performance mufflers use straight-through, low restriction baffling.
Reduced Restriction - Resonators, catalytic converters and other components are minimized or removed entirely.
Lighter Weight - Advanced materials like aluminized steel and stainless steel reduce system weight.
Scavenging Effect - Reduced backpressure helps pull more spent gases from the cylinders.
Combined, these performance-oriented characteristics allow more exhaust gases to be evacuated faster, which enables the engine to generate more horsepower and torque output.

Exhaust Diameter - Bigger is Better
When shopping for a cat-back performance exhaust system, pay close attention to the piping diameter. Wider tubes measurably reduce backpressure which enables the engine to generate more usable horsepower and torque. Here are some common 4x4 exhaust sizes:
2.25” - 2.5”: Good for modest power gains on smaller 4-cylinder engines.
2.5” - 3”: Provides substantial improvements for average V6 applications.
3” - 5”: The ideal range for maximizing horsepower on full-size V8s and diesels.
Single exhaust systems typically range from 2.25” - 3”. Dual configurations commonly start around 2.5” and go up to 5” diameter piping. Match the pipe diameter to your particular 4x4’s engine size and desired power increase.

Weeping tiles are an essential component of a building's system. These tiles are designed to collect and redirect excess water away from the structure's foundation, preventing water from seeping into the basement or causing damage to the foundation walls. In Calgary, as in many other areas with varying weather conditions, weep tiles play an important role in maintaining the structural integrity of buildings and preventing basement flooding.
Here are some key points about weep tiles in Calgary:
Purpose of Weeping Tiles: Weeping tiles are typically installed just below ground level, around the perimeter of a building's foundation. Their primary purpose is to collect groundwater and surface water that may accumulate around foundations. By directing this water away from the building, they help prevent water from seeping into the basement, which can lead to dampness, mildew growth, and structural damage.
Calgary's Climate: Calgary experiences a variety of weather conditions throughout the year, including heavy rainfall and snow melt in the spring and summer, as well as cooler temperatures in the winter. These weather patterns can cause water to pool around the foundation, making proper drainage systems including rowing tiles essential.
Installation and Maintenance: Weeping tiles are typically installed during construction of a building or as part of a foundation waterproofing or drainage system upgrade. Regular maintenance is necessary to ensure that they remain functional. Over time, debris, silt and tree roots can block or damage weeping tiles, reducing their effectiveness. Periodic inspection and cleaning is recommended. Materials and Technology: Weeping tiles can be made from a variety of materials, including clay, plastic, or corrugated pipe. Modern systems often use perforated plastic pipes surrounded by gravel to facilitate water collection and drainage. Some advanced systems also incorporate filtration technology to prevent blockages and improve longevity.

What is a French Drain System?
A French drain system is a subsurface drainage solution designed to redirect excess water away from your home or property. The system works by creating a shallow trench filled with gravel or other porous materials. The trench is sloped away from your property to allow water to flow naturally towards the lower point of the trench.
When it rains, water enters the trench and is directed to a perforated drainage pipe located at the bottom of the trench. The drainage pipe carries the water away from your property to a more suitable location such as a stormwater retention pond or a street gutter.
French drain systems are typically installed around the perimeter of a property, but they can also be used to manage water in specific areas such as a garden or lawn. The system is effective in preventing water from pooling around your property, which can lead to soil erosion, foundation damage, and even basement flooding.
What is a Corrugated Drainage Pipe?
A corrugated drainage pipe is a flexible plastic pipe with a series of ridges or corrugations on the outside. The ridges make the pipe stronger and more durable, allowing it to withstand the weight of soil and other materials without collapsing. Corrugated drainage pipes come in various sizes and lengths, making them suitable for a range of drainage applications.
Corrugated drainage pipes are widely used in French drain systems because they are easy to install and require minimal maintenance. The perforated design of the pipe allows water to enter from the sides and bottom, which helps to prevent clogging and ensures efficient drainage.

Are you tired of water pooling around your house or basement? A French drain is a simple solution that can prevent water damage to your property. In this article, we will guide you on how to install a French drain, step by step.
What is a French drain?
A French drain is a trench filled with gravel or rock that redirects surface and groundwater away from your house or property. The drain is sloped downward, allowing water to flow towards a designated outlet, such as a dry well or storm drain. A French drain can prevent water from damaging your home's foundation, basement, or yard.
Step 1: Plan the French drain installation
Before you start digging, plan the French drain installation. Identify the area where the water is pooling and determine where you want the drain to lead. Make sure the slope is adequate to allow the water to flow away from your property.
Step 2: Dig the trench
Using a shovel or a trenching machine, dig a trench that is at least 18 inches deep and 12 inches wide. The trench should slope downwards, with a minimum grade of 1% or 1/8 inch per foot. If you need to turn the trench, create a gentle curve to prevent water from getting trapped in corners.
Step 3: Add a layer of gravel
Place a layer of gravel or rock at the bottom of the trench, about 2-3 inches deep. The gravel will help to filter the water and prevent clogging.
Step 4: Install the perforated drain pipe
Lay the perforated drain pipe on top of the gravel, with the perforations facing down. Connect the drain pipe to a solid pipe that will lead the water away from your property. Use PVC pipes or corrugated plastic pipes for the solid pipe.
Step 5: Cover the drain pipe with gravel
Cover the drain pipe with another layer of gravel, about 4-6 inches deep. Make sure the gravel covers the pipe completely, leaving no gaps. The gravel will help to filter the water and prevent debris from entering the pipe.
Step 6: Cover the trench
Cover the trench with soil and pack it firmly to prevent settling. Make sure the soil is sloped away from your property to prevent water from flowing back towards your home.
Step 7: Test the French drain
After the installation, test the French drain by pouring water into the trench. Observe how the water flows and check for any leaks or clogs. Make any necessary adjustments to ensure the drain is working properly.
